SNIA Dev. Conf. / Plug Fest

I'm slowly getting caught up from the DevConf/PlugFest last week. Once I'm back to normal I will post some highlights. I just wanted to send out a quick note of thanks to all those iSCSI vendors that attended the PlugFest and the individuals that attended my presentation on the Solaris iSCSI Initiator. You can access the slides from my presentation by one of the following to links. (staroffice) (pdf)

The number one comment I heard from people related to the Solaris iSCSI Initiator was "When is it going to ship?" It was nice to be able to say you can download it today as part of Solaris Express. I wish I could have said, Download Solaris 10 Update 1 today. Although the feature list for Solaris 10 Update 1 is still growing so it will be well worth the wait.

This years Plug Fest attendance was pretty light so Sun is going to start drumming up support early for next years 2006 Connectathon. Sun has had a long history with Connectathon promoting interop testing with NIF/CIFS/etc. So we are going to continue promoting Connectathon for iSCSI.
